Originally posted by Healy52003 Healy52003 wrote:

Not irish related but just curious 

Could somone born in San Marino play for Italy and vice versa ?


Same eligibility rules would apply to them as everyone else. They'd need a parent or grand parent born in either country or become eligible through gaining citizenship themselves.

It is an independent Republic and not a territory of another country like Gibraltar/UK, Faroes/Denmark etc..
